Pretend Play with Play Dough

Play dough gives kids infinite play possibilities. Start with good dough, either homemade or store bought, add accessories, think of a play theme, and you’ll see hours of creative play!

Play Dough Accessory Ideas

cookie cutters
rolling pins
kid knives
play kitchen set
buttons
plates
paper muffin cups
sticks
wiggly eyes
pipe cleaners
straws
toothpicks
kid scissors
plastic animals
cupcake toppers (ask your local bakery)
rocks
apron and chef hat 

Play Dough Play Theme Ideas

Bakery
Restaurant
Picnic
Jungle
Dinosaurs
City with Cars
Words and Letters
Pizza
Volcano
Reading activity (listen and create)
Circuits (for older kids)
Monsters

Basic Play Dough Recipe

1 cup water
1 cup flour
1 Tbspn vegetable oil
1/2 cup salt
1 Tbspn cream of tarter
food coloring (I use the cake decorating colors b/c they’re much brighter.)

Combine in a saucepan on low to medium-low a few minutes until smooth. Knead when cool. Store in freezer bag.
